Output 62d620a107c84619dd3021cf8e12f039374de02aec0dce9974a376594608a740:1

value
13079516
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b5d78c7387f9d18d158bf348d15a0fd50dfa10a7 OP_EQUALVERIFY OP_CHECKSIG
address
1HaVXJb3FCoboUGztVj9wLrH746PCnPeUe
transaction
62d620a107c84619dd3021cf8e12f039374de02aec0dce9974a376594608a740
spent
true